Hi Karen,

Glad to hear from you! I'm sorry to hear that you are having a hard time in B.C. trying to find a doctor. And I thought it just was people living in Ontario who were having a hard time finding doctors. There are people who come here who live in B.C. I hope one of them can help you and suggest a doctor there.
I have had IC now for about 8 years. I've tried many different drugs and combinations of treatments and drugs. Right now I'm on the Rimso and Heparin
treatments. Not both at once, I do about 8 treatments of Rimso and then go on Heparin treatments to maintain where I get to. I also take Elavil and Ursipas (spelling sorry) Most days are bad for me, I have a few good days a week. But mostly I find I'm just trying to cope.
I mentioned eating the Krispy Kreme donuts, I don't usually eat food such as that, this was just a small treat. They were devoured by my husband.
I actually have dealt with IBS also. I don't get it alot, when I do is enough!
I am trying out different pain meds right now, I don't want to take more than I need and find that what I was on was too much. I don't like the drugged feeling at all. I need to have a life of some sort.
Anyhow, I hope that you find a doctor soon. It helps when you can get proper treatments and medicine that helps.
One more thing that I forgot to mention, I was on Elmiron for a while, but found it to cause me more side effects than it was helping.
I might try it again some day, when I've run out of other options.
